How Kleanland Electrostatic Precipitators assist lessen Airborne Particles in Textile production

The textile dyeing and finishing method generates substantial quantities of oil-bearing fumes and natural and organic compounds, which includes textile auxiliaries. These fumes can reach densities of around 80mg/m3, posing really serious wellbeing risks to staff and contributing to air air pollution. Kleanland esp utilize advanced electrostatic precipitation technological know-how to seize and remove these airborne particles effectively. By producing an electrostatic cost, the ESP appeals to and collects even the smallest particles, making certain the air produced from textile factories is significantly cleaner. This not only will help safeguard the setting but will also makes a safer Doing work environment for workers.

Why Electrostatic Precipitators Are important for Controlling Emissions in Textile Processing vegetation

Electrostatic precipitators, notably Those people built by Kleanland, are essential for controlling emissions in textile processing vegetation. These vegetation generally manage several different pollutants, like natural oils, dyes, dye auxiliaries, lubricant oils, and fiber particles. standard air filtration techniques battle to handle such a various choice of contaminants properly. nevertheless, the advanced ESP technological innovation used by Kleanland captures these pollutants with higher performance. by utilizing a combination of drinking water scrubbers, twin-push large spacing esp, and oil and drinking water separators, Kleanland esp make sure exhaust gases are handled comprehensively ahead of staying released in the environment. This comprehensive approach would make them an important component in modern day textile producing services, aiding providers comply with stringent environmental polices.
